Stephen Colbert opened Tuesday's "Colbert Report" by reacting to the Supreme Court striking down a key part of the Voting Rights Act of 1965. He feigned outrage, since the law is "It's like those outdated labor laws that prevent kids from threading bobbins in a loom!"
